About Furman University

Furman University is a highly selective institution with 2,322 students. The college maintains high academic standards with average SAT scores of 1342 and ACT scores of 30.0. Understanding these costs upfront allows families to create an effective savings strategy for their Furman University education fund.

Current Furman University Costs

  • In-State Tuition: $58,312 per year
  • Out-of-State Tuition: $58,312 per year
  • Total Students: 2,322
  • Admission Rate: 52.6%
